Another Solid Sale in Harrison Township: 652 Syracuse Avenue
The recently closed sale at 652 Syracuse Avenue brings a nicely updated 3-bedroom, 1-bath home into the “sold” column at a final price of $125,000. While it isn’t a record-breaking number for the area, it’s a healthy, solid comp for Harrison Township’s Riverdale neighborhood and a good indicator of stable values for nearby homeowners and investors.

Built in 1921, this home blends classic Dayton architecture with modern updates that make day-to-day living easy. With approximately 1,088 square feet of living space, the layout is efficient and welcoming rather than oversized or overwhelming—exactly what many buyers are looking for in today’s market.
The main level features a comfortable living room that flows into the dining area, creating a natural gathering space for everyday routines or small get-togethers. Fresh finishes, updated flooring, and a clean, neutral color palette help the space feel bright without losing its original character.

The kitchen continues the theme with contemporary cabinetry, updated countertops, and a functional layout that makes good use of the square footage. It’s the kind of space where a new owner can move in on day one and start cooking without needing immediate renovations—always a plus for first-time buyers or anyone working within a tight budget.

Below, a full unfinished basement offers extra storage and potential for future projects, whether that’s a workshop, hobby room, or additional living space down the road. Outside, a 2-car detached garage, manageable yard, and convenient location close to downtown Dayton, schools, and major routes round out the property’s appeal.
